      Understanding the Rotary Cement Kiln

      Structure and Functionality

      A rotary cement kiln is a long, cylindrical vessel, slightly inclined from the horizontal, which rotates slowly around its axis. Raw materials, primarily limestone and clay, are introduced at the higher end, and as the kiln rotates, these materials move gradually towards the lower end. During this journey, they undergo a series of chemical reactions at elevated temperatures, ultimately forming clinker. The kiln's internal environment is meticulously controlled to facilitate these reactions, making it an indispensable component in cement production.

      Key Components

      • Shell: The outer steel structure providing the kiln's shape and strength.

      • Refractory Lining: Heat-resistant materials lining the interior to protect the shell and retain heat.

      • Support Tyres and Rollers: Bear the kiln's weight and facilitate its rotation.

      • Drive Gear: Powers the rotation of the kiln.

      • Burner Pipe: Introduces fuel for combustion, generating the necessary heat.

      The Significance of Rotary Kilns in Cement Manufacturing

      Efficient Clinker Production

      The rotary kiln's design ensures uniform heat distribution, crucial for the consistent production of high-quality clinker. This uniformity directly impacts the strength and durability of the final cement product.

      Energy Optimization

      Modern rotary kilns, such as those developed by Jiangsu Yuli Energy Saving Technology Co., Ltd., incorporate advanced features like preheaters and precalciners. These additions enhance thermal efficiency, reducing fuel consumption and lowering operational costs.

      Environmental Considerations

      With growing environmental concerns, rotary kilns have evolved to minimize emissions. Innovations include waste heat recovery systems and the utilization of alternative fuels, aligning cement production with sustainable practices.
